It's all about water

The Rogue River conditions are continuing to improve day by day. The fishing has picked up in the Lower River , the reason why is Ocean conditions having temps in the 52-54f, these fish do not want to commit they come in with the tides , and some go the rest tulle' back out. The one good thing is that water conditions in the river are at best , with the temps raising as well, a nice grade of fish are entering the systems and numbers will follow, see you soon on the Rogue

Spring Chinook water update


Well the big storm on Saturday , just about blew as hard as it could with rain , more wind , and hail to boot. I for one didn't fish cause I didn't think I could keep the boat in line to fish the way I like , good choice for the Boss as it turned out , my clients were happy , and they'll do it another day. Water flows have jumped to 11,400 CFS this morning at Agness, w/3000 CFS in the other streams , conditions as of this report are 51.2f , with still climbing water , when the fall occurs it will be the bite that the Rogue has been looking for this week , all of the fish that we have boated as of late have had all small bait fish in them , that why we haven't been seeing allot of fish cause I think they been outside on the feed this last storm will change all of that , so to put it in a nut shell , get some days off , load in the rig and head for Gold Beach, to enjoy Spring Chinook when this water turns the other way , see you soon enough say .................
